Adivasis set up huts in forest, seek land

Pathanamthitta, June 21 (UNI) Adivasis and people belonging to backward sections tresspassed into the Konni Forest area and set up huts in 'Muthanga style' last night and early today.

This was part of Vedi's agitation under the banner of Sadhujana Vimochana Samyuktha Vedi.They agigationists were demanding five acre of land per family.

The encroachment focussed on forest land under possession of Plantation Corporation, taken on lease for planting rubber trees.

Most of the illegal occupation occurred at Kompana and Anakoottam in Kodumon Plantation and Ezhumon and Elappupara in Chandapally Plantation.

An attempt by the Vedi activists to storm 350 acre of controversial forest land and Kallely, near Konni, was foilded by forest personnel and police.

The encroachers comprised of tribals and others from Pathanamthitta, Kollam and Thiruvananthapuram districts. Last year, the Vedi staged a 'marathon dharna' lasting 200 days at the gate of Pathanamthitta Civil Station.

Those spearheading the action included Convener Laha Gopalan, President P K Suseelan and Secretary N Karunakaran. Even women and children participated in the agitation.

Rapid Action Force of Police and Forest Guards were keeping vigil at the troubled areas.

According to police, the situation was tense but under control.

Meanwhile, 'peace talks' held by ADM B Mohan, officiating as District Collector, Adoor RDO Maheswaran and Adoor Deputy SP Asok Kumar with the Vedi State Leaders I K Raveendra Raj, P K Suseelan, N Karunakaran and Ramani Satheesh, proved futile.
